Which set of organizational policies and procedures would best describe the process for moving modified source code into production?
A. Change Management
B. Asset Management
C. Acceptable Use
D. Data Governance
Correct Answer: A
Change management policies describe the process for requesting, reviewing, implementing, and deploying changes in a production environment. This includes the release of new source code to production use. Asset management policies are used to track hardware, software, and other assets belonging to the organization. Acceptable use policies place restrictions on how users may interact with technology systems. Data governance policies set forth requirements for data ownership, stewardship, and care.
